Ingredients
Scale
Turkey Burger Mixture
- 1 lb ground turkey
- 1/4 cup breadcrumbs
- 1/4 cup finely chopped onion
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 egg
- 1 tbsp Dijon mustard
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p dried oregano
- Salt and pepper, to taste
For Cooking and Serving
- Olive oil, for cooking
- 4 burger buns
- Optional toppings: lettuce, tomato, avocado, cheese, pickles
Instructions
- Prepare the Turkey Mixture: In a large bowl, combine ground turkey, breadcrumbs, chopped onion, Parmesan cheese, egg, Dijon mustard, garlic powder, oregano, salt, and pepper. Mix gently until just combined, taking care not to overmix to ensure the burgers remain tender.
- Shape the Patties: Divide the mixture into 4 equal portions. Shape each portion into a patty slightly larger than the buns to accommodate shrinkage during cooking.
- Cook the Burgers: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Place the patties in the skillet and cook for 5-6 minutes on each side until golden brown and an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C) is reached for safe consumption.
- Assemble the Burgers: Toast the burger buns if desired. Place the cooked turkey patties on the buns and top with optional toppings such as lettuce, tomato, avocado, cheese, or pickles as per your preference.
- Serve and Enjoy: Serve the turkey burgers immediately with your choice of sides like sweet potato fries, a fresh salad, or roasted vegetables for a complete meal.
Notes
- For juicier burgers, avoid overmixing the meat mixture.
- Make sure patties are cooked to an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C) to ensure they are safe to eat.
- Feel free to customize toppings according to your taste preferences.
- Using fresh breadcrumbs can enhance the texture of the patties.
- To add extra flavor, consider adding a splash of Worcestershire sauce or fresh herbs like parsley to the mixture.
